In the UK at least, yes.  See rule 264 here:

http://www.direct.gov.uk/en/TravelAndTransport/Highwaycode/DG_069862

Also rule 268 allows you to "undertake" if the conditions are busy and your 
lane is simply going faster than the other lanes (ie you are not expected to 
brake to avoid undertaking someone if the other lane slows down).

But crucially there is no "MUST NOT" related to any of this, so it seems 
there is no specific law that applies in this situation.  I assume it would 
just be down to a police officier whether he judged what you were doing as 
dangerous or not.  You would probably need a pretty good explanation as to 
why to undertook given that the highway code tells you not to.  I don't know 
whether they would accept "someone was hogging the overtaking lane" as a 
valid reason.
